2Why Compress JPG Files Online?
Faster Website Loading
Images account for over 50% of the average web page's total weight. Uncompressed JPG photos from modern smartphones can be 5-15MB each, creating massive loading delays. Compressing JPG file online before uploading to your website can reduce image sizes by 60-80% without visible quality loss, dramatically improving page speed and user experience.
Email Attachment Compliance
Email providers typically limit attachments to 25MB. A handful of high-resolution photos can easily exceed this. By compressing before attaching, you can share more photos in a single email while staying within limits.
Social Media Optimization
Platforms like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ter automatically compress uploaded images, often with unpredictable results. Pre-compressing your images gives you control over the final quality and ensures your photos look their best.
Storage Efficiency
Whether you are managing cloud storage, backing up photos, or organizing a digital archive, compressed JPGs save significant space. A collection of 1,000 photos compressed from 5MB to 500KB each saves over 4.5GB of storage.
3Top Methods to JPG Compress Online
Method 1: Quality-Based Compression
The most common approach to jpg compress online is adjusting the quality parameter. JPG quality ranges from 1 (maximum compression, worst quality) to 100 (minimum compression, best quality). For most purposes, a quality setting of 75-85 provides an excellent balance, reducing file size by 50-70% while maintaining visual quality that is virtually indistinguishable from the original.

Method 3: Dimension-Based Compression
Resizing an image to smaller dimensions is one of the most effective ways to reduce file size. A 4000x3000 pixel photo contains 12 million pixels, while a 800x600 version contains only 480,000 — a 96% reduction in data.
